Finasteride is one of the only medications which is licensed in the UK to treat male pattern hair loss, so doing everything you can to improve its results is crucial. Is your Finasteride not working the way you would like it to? Here are some simple ways to help make your journey with Finasteride that bit more successful.

 

Minoxidil

Using Minoxidil alongside Finasteride can help improve the results achieved. Minoxidil comes in the form of a topical solution applied to the scalp - which increases blood flow oxygen in your blood vessels and revitalises shrunken or damaged hair follicles in your scalp. It is also available as an oral capsule, which can also be used with Finasteride. When used together, Minoxidil and Finasteride, are clinically-proven to be an effective hair loss treatment for men.

 

Consistency

Like any other medication, Finasteride requires consistent use. It’s important that you don’t miss any tablets, as consistently missing tablets can have a huge impact on your hair loss treatment. We recommend incorporating Finasteride into your daily routine, i.e. taking them after you brush your teeth, or setting a daily alarm that reminds you to take it.
